Arsenal Agree Deal for Star Signing on Long-Term Contract Worth Over £100 Million.

Arsenal have reportedly made significant progress in negotiations with Aston Villa attacking midfielder Morgan Rogers, with sources indicating that a five-year contract is already in principle agreement.

The deal remains contingent on reaching an agreement with Aston Villa, who are likely to demand a significant transfer fee for the player, reportedly as high as £130m, although insiders expect the final price to be closer to £100m with add-ons potentially taking it to £115-20m.

Arsenal's pursuit of Rogers and Newcastle's Bruno Guimaraes is seen as a key part of the club's plan to retain their Premier League title and build on their success in the 2025/26 season.

The addition of these two top Premier League players would be a significant statement of intent from Mikel Arteta's side, who have won 14 league titles in their history, including four in the Premier League era.

AFC's ambition to win the Champions League has also been renewed, following their second ever Champions League final appearance, although the trophy remains elusive.
